FIBC stands for Flexible Intermediate Bulk Container. Most people just call them bulk bags or big bags. They’re large woven polypropylene sacks used to store, move, and ship dry bulk materials in quantities from a few hundred kilograms up to around two tonnes.

Mine sites don’t offer gentle handling. Bags get filled with sharp, heavy ore, stacked two or three high, and moved across rough, uneven ground. A weak seam or thin fabric will show its limits fast.

Bags used for hazardous ore by-products may also need UN certification, which confirms they meet international requirements for transporting dangerous goods by road, rail, or sea.
